Handover Note — Joint Venture Proposal

To my successor: the proposed venture between Calbright Materials and Osterhal Foundries remains at term-sheet stage. Finance should note the 60/40 capital split, the five-year exit clause, and the unresolved question of IP ownership for the Verano coating process. Due diligence closes next month. Our confidential position on the venture's purpose is recorded below.

board note of fahif-yahog: Gross margin on Wenath came in at 10 percent against a plan of 5 percent. Only 3 of the 100 pilot accounts renewed Wenath, so a churn review is set for July 15.

This PR adds the first cut of the Ferngate schema registry for our event bus. Producers register schemas at startup, consumers validate against cached copies, and incompatible changes get rejected at publish time. Nothing fancy yet — caching and retry behavior are intentionally simple. Heads up: all the knobs live in one place, shown below.

tuning constants:
QUOTAS = {
    "druwyn": 5,
    "holix": 5,
    "zorath": 5,
    "holwyn": 10,
}

## Tuning the Backfill Scheduler

The Nightglass scheduler assigns backfill jobs to worker pools after the evening traffic dip. Before adjusting anything, read the capacity notes in the runbook: the window size and concurrency cap interact, and raising one without lowering the other has overloaded the warehouse twice. Change values only via reviewed config commits. The current constants are shown below.

tuning constants:
RATE_LIMITS = {
    "wenwyn": 1,
    "zorix": 10,
    "oliix": 2,
    "holael": 10,
}